Vietnamese cuisine has found a natural home in Singapore, thriving in a city that shares the same love of fresh herbs, bold broths, and food eaten at any hour of the day. From slow-simmered pho that takes the better part of a day to prepare, to crisp bánh mì filled with house-made fillings, the Vietnamese restaurants in Singapore range from casual neighbourhood spots to polished dining rooms. The quality across the board is high, and the range of dishes available goes well beyond the classics.

Whether you are a longtime fan of Vietnamese cooking or discovering it for the first time, this list covers the eleven best Vietnamese restaurants in Singapore right now, spread across the city from Orchard Road to Geylang to the CBD.

1. Co Hai Banh Mi & Phở Vietnamese Restaurant

Co Hai Banh Mi & Phở Vietnamese RestauranT

Co Hai Banh Mi & Phở Vietnamese Restaurant. Source: danielfooddairy

  • Address: 359 Beach Rd,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 11:00 am to 10: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$10–15 per dish

A visit to Co Hai Banh Mi & Phở Vietnamese Restaurant is a must for anyone searching for authentic Vietnamese food in Singapore.

This eatery's homemade baguettes add a delightful crunch to their famous banh mi.

Their pho is equally impressive, featuring a flavourful broth simmered for hours to extract the best taste from the beef bones.

With a cosy ambience and hospitality, this restaurant brings a little Vietnam in Singapore to life.

2. Ăn Là Ghiền-Authentic Vietnamese Cuisine

Vietnamese barbecue and hotpot

Vietnamese barbecue and hotpot

  • Address: 45 Lor 27 Geylang,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 12:00–10: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$15–25 per dish

Specialising in Vietnamese barbecue and hotpot, Ăn Là Ghiền sets itself apart with its unique flavours and cooking techniques.

Their signature hotpot platters feature a mix of proteins and fresh vegetables for sharing.

The restaurant also provides delicious à la carte dishes, like Duck Noodles with Bamboo Shoots and Minced Pork Lolot Noodles.

For those seeking Geylang Vietnamese food, this restaurant is a top choice.

3. Long Phung Vietnamese Cuisine

Long Phung Vietnamese Cuisine

Long Phung Vietnamese Cuisine. Source: danielfooddairy

  • Address: 159 Joo Chiat Rd,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 11:00 am to 11: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$10–20 per dish

Long Phung Vietnamese Cuisine is recognised for serving some of the best pho in Singapore.

The menu includes traditional dishes such as Com Thit Kho Hot Vit (braised pork with rice) and Pho Tai (rare beef pho).

The bustling atmosphere and authentic flavours make it a beloved destination for Vietnamese food in Singapore Joo Chiat visitors.

4. VietSmith

VietSmith

VietSmith. Source: Deliveryhero

  • Address: 9 Raffles Blvd, #01-88/89/90 Millenia Walk,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 11:00 am to 10: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$12–20 per dish

VietSmith stands out with its premium take on classic Vietnamese dishes.

Their pho selection includes oxtail pho and beef meatball pho, which offer a satisfying taste.

The grilled dishes are perfect for sharing, such as the Signature Grilled Saigon Chicken.

If you are searching for an elevated Vietnamese dining experience, this spot is worth a visit.

5. Banh Mi Thit by Star Baguette

Banh Mi Thit by Star Baguette

Banh Mi Thit by Star Baguette. Source: Misstamchiak

  • Address: 543 Geylang Rd,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: Tue–Sat 10:30 am to 9:00 pm, Sun 10:00 am to 9:30 pm
  • Average Price: SG$5–8 per sandwich

Banh Mi Thit by Star Baguette is well-known for serving some of the cheapest Vietnamese food in Singapore.

Their banh mi is generously filled with fresh ingredients and their signature sauce, available with different protein options.

The crispy baguette and flavourful fillings make it a favourite among budget-conscious foodies.

6. Banh Mi Saigon

Banh Mi Saigon

Banh Mi Saigon. Source: danielfooddairy

  • Address: 505 Ang Mo Kio Ave 8, #01-2668,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 9:00 am to 9: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$7–10 per sandwich

A hidden gem in Ang Mo Kio, Banh Mi Saigon offers 13 different bánh mì variations with authentic Vietnamese flavours.

Their Special Great Banh Mi Cha Lua is a best-seller, featuring cold cuts with a hint of peppercorn spice.

The baguettes are baked fresh daily to ensure a crispy crust and airy interior that complements the fillings beautifully.

For those who enjoy bold flavours, their Spicy Lemongrass Chicken Banh Mi offers a fragrant and savoury punch in every bite.

7. Mrs Pho Kitchen

Mrs Pho Kitchen

Mrs Pho Kitchen. Source: danielfooddairy

  • Address: 313@somerset, Orchard Rd, #01-16 313,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 11:00 am to 10: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$10–18 per dish

Mrs Pho Kitchen is a must-visit for fans of pho and traditional Vietnamese dishes.

Their menu features rich beef pho, fragrant vermicelli bowls, and delightful sides such as grilled skewers and fried spring rolls.

This eatery is a great spot to enjoy a comforting bowl of pho in a casual yet inviting setting.

Mrs Pho Singapore fans will appreciate the attention to detail in their dishes.

8. Signs A Taste of Vietnam Pho

Signs A Taste of Vietnam Pho

Signs A Taste of Vietnam Pho. Source: danielfooddairy

  • Address: 277 Orchard Road, #B2-03 Orchard Gateway,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: Mon–Sat 11:00 am to 8:30 pm
  • Average Price: S$10–15 per dish

This unique restaurant is run by a deaf Vietnamese couple who employ hearing-impaired staff.

Their signature beef pho is packed with flavour, with a well-seasoned broth and generous portions of beef.

Therefore, a visit to this restaurant not only guarantees a satisfying meal but also supports an inspiring social cause.

9. Super Ngon Vietnamese Noodle Cafe

Super Ngon Vietnamese Noodle Cafe

Super Ngon Vietnamese Noodle Cafe

  • Address: 8 Club St, B2-24 ICON Link@ClubStreet, Mercure ICON Singapore City Centre,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: Mon–Sat 10:00 am to 8:00 pm, Sun 10:00 am to 3:00 pm
  • Average Price: SG$9–15 per dish

For affordable Vietnamese cuisine, Super Ngon is a fantastic option.

Their Beef and Chicken Pho is well-seasoned and comforting, priced at just S$9.

Don't miss their Vietnamese-style Fried Dough Sticks for an extra treat.

The menu includes Vietnamese coffee and spring rolls for a complete meal experience.

10. May Pho Culture

May Pho Culture

May Pho Culture. Source: danielfooddairy

  • Address: 150 South Bridge Rd, #01-16,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 10:45 am to 9: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: S$15 – S$20 per dish

May Pho Culture is renowned for its Southern-style pho, which boasts a richer broth that enhances the flavour of tender beef slices.

The broth is simmered for hours, allowing the flavours to deepen and develop a hearty taste.

In addition to pho, the eatery also serves various Vietnamese street food, from crispy spring rolls to fragrant rice dishes.

Its diverse menu makes it an exciting place to explore many authentic Vietnamese foods.

11. Moc Quan

Moc Quan

Moc Quan. Source: Wherecrowded.sg

  • Address: 81 Clemenceau Ave, #01-23, Singapore
  • Opening Hours: 11:00 am to 9:00 pm daily
  • Average Price: SG$10–18 per dish

Moc Quan prides itself on using fresh ingredients imported from Vietnam to ensure the authenticity of its dishes.

Their Pho Bo is well-loved for its aromatic broth, and their Banh Mi is among the best in the city.

This is a great place for those looking to explore traditional Vietnamese flavours.

Overall, if you are looking for authentic Vietnamese food in Singapore, these restaurants won’t disappoint.

Whether you crave a comforting bowl of pho or a crispy banh mi, you are sure to find a spot that satisfies your appetite.
